WebFeb 3, 2024 · Key takeaways: Current assets are short-term assets that a company expects to liquidate and spend in one year or less, while non-current assets are long-term investments that aren’t easy to liquidate and have an expected life of more than a year. Examples of current assets include cash, cash equivalents and accounts receivable, … WebJun 28, 2024 · It includes only the quick assets which are the more liquid assets of the company. Quick Ratio Formula = (Cash and Cash Equivalents + Marketable Securities + Accounts Receivable)/ (Current Liabilities) 3. Cash Ratio.
